FLEXIBLE PLASTICS CORP. v. BLACK MOUNTAIN SP. WATER INC.

No. C-70 2020.

357 F.Supp. 554 (1972)

FLEXIBLE PLASTICS CORPORATION, Plaintiff, v. BLACK MOUNTAIN SPRING WATER INCORPORATED, Defendant.

United States District Court, N. D. California.

August 10, 1972.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Harris, Kiech, Russell & Kern, Warren L. Kern, David S. Romney, Los Angeles, Cal., Flehr, Hohbach, Test, Albritton & Herbert, Elmer S. Albritton, David J. Brezner, San Francisco, Cal., for defendant.

Townsend & Townsend, Stephen S. Townsend, Thomas H. Olson, J. Georg Seka, San Francisco, Cal., for plaintiff.


ORDER GRANTING DEFENDANT'S MOTION FOR SUMMARY JUDGMENT

ZIRPOLI, District Judge.

This is a suit for patent infringement brought by Flexible Plastics Corporation against Black Mountain Spring Water, Inc. alleging that the defendant has infringed the plaintiff's patented design for a plastic jug. The patent in suit is United States Patent Des. 199,590 entitled "Jug," which was filed on March 15, 1963 and issued on November 17, 1964. The court has jurisdiction...
